news 2026/4/28 16:27:37

实战:用M3U直播源搭建家庭影音中心

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
实战:用M3U直播源搭建家庭影音中心

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个M3U直播源管理应用,功能包括:1. 内置优质直播源数据库 2. 一键导入Kodi/VLC等播放器 3. 直播源有效性测试工具 4. 频道分类管理 5. 用户评分系统。要求界面简洁易用,支持Windows/macOS平台,使用Electron框架开发。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

最近想给家里搭建一个稳定的电视直播系统,发现M3U直播源是个不错的解决方案。经过一番折腾,终于用Electron开发了一个管理应用,把整个过程记录下来分享给大家。

  1. 为什么选择M3U直播源M3U是一种播放列表格式,可以存储多个直播流地址。相比传统机顶盒,它的优势在于:
  2. 片源丰富,国内外频道都能找到
  3. 画质可选,从480p到4K都有
  4. 完全免费,省去有线电视费用
  5. 跨平台支持,各种设备都能播放

  6. 应用核心功能设计为了让家人也能方便使用,我设计了这几个主要功能模块:

  7. 直播源数据库:内置经过筛选的稳定源,按国家/类型分类
  8. 导入导出工具:一键生成Kodi/VLC能识别的播放列表
  9. 实时检测功能:自动测试直播源是否有效
  10. 收藏系统:标记常用频道,支持自定义分类
  11. 社区评分:用户可以为直播源打分,帮助筛选优质资源

  1. 技术实现要点用Electron开发跨平台桌面应用时,有几个关键点需要注意:
  2. 使用Node.js的fs模块处理本地文件读写
  3. 通过axios实现直播源的实时检测
  4. 采用lowdb作为轻量级本地数据库
  5. 界面用Vue+ElementUI保证美观易用
  6. 打包时配置好各平台的安装包格式

  7. 实际使用技巧经过一段时间的使用,总结出这些经验:

  8. 建议每天自动检测一次直播源有效性
  9. 海外频道最好搭配代理使用
  10. 体育直播源需要经常更新维护
  11. 可以设置备选源提高稳定性
  12. 家人常用的频道要置顶显示

  13. 可能遇到的问题新手在使用时可能会遇到:

  14. 部分直播源需要特定解码器
  15. 高峰期可能出现卡顿
  16. 某些地区会屏蔽特定源
  17. 播放器需要正确配置缓冲参数
  18. 老旧设备可能不支持高码率

整个开发过程在InsCode(快马)平台上完成特别顺畅,它的在线编辑器响应很快,内置的终端调试也很方便。最惊喜的是可以直接把应用部署成可访问的网页版,家人用手机也能管理直播源,不用每台设备都安装客户端。对于这种需要持续运行的服务类项目,一键部署功能真的省去了很多配置环境的麻烦。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个M3U直播源管理应用,功能包括:1. 内置优质直播源数据库 2. 一键导入Kodi/VLC等播放器 3. 直播源有效性测试工具 4. 频道分类管理 5. 用户评分系统。要求界面简洁易用,支持Windows/macOS平台,使用Electron框架开发。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/27 21:09:16

AI助力WINTOGO开发:自动生成便携系统工具

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个WINTOGO辅助工具,主要功能包括:1.自动检测硬件兼容性并生成报告 2.智能修复UEFI引导问题 3.自动安装必要驱动程序 4.提供系统优化建议。使用Python…

作者头像 李华
网站建设 2026/4/27 21:10:17

AI如何帮你轻松理解四元数?

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个交互式四元数学习工具,包含以下功能:1) 四元数基础概念讲解 2) 四元数与欧拉角转换的可视化演示 3) 自动生成四元数旋转的代码示例(支持C/Python) …

作者头像 李华
网站建设 2026/4/27 10:22:10

Emotion2Vec+ Large在线教学辅助?教师授课情绪优化建议生成

Emotion2Vec Large在线教学辅助?教师授课情绪优化建议生成 1. 引言:让AI读懂课堂上的“情绪语言” 你有没有想过,一节45分钟的课,老师的声音里藏着多少情绪密码?是激情澎湃的讲解,还是疲惫低沉的重复&…

作者头像 李华
网站建设 2026/4/25 9:26:44

Qwen2.5-0.5B镜像优势:免环境配置,快速上线

Qwen2.5-0.5B镜像优势:免环境配置,快速上线 1. 轻松上手的极速对话体验 你是否曾因为部署一个AI模型而陷入复杂的环境依赖、CUDA版本冲突或显存不足的困境?现在,这一切都可以被彻底绕开。基于 Qwen/Qwen2.5-0.5B-Instruct 的轻量…

作者头像 李华
网站建设 2026/4/28 14:38:25

PyTorch-2.x-Universal-Dev-v1.0镜像ipykernel内核配置指南

PyTorch-2.x-Universal-Dev-v1.0镜像ipykernel内核配置指南 1. 镜像环境与Jupyter内核简介 PyTorch-2.x-Universal-Dev-v1.0镜像是一个为深度学习开发量身打造的通用环境,基于官方PyTorch底包构建,预装了常用的数据处理、可视化和Jupyter开发工具。该镜…

作者头像 李华
网站建设 2026/4/23 15:34:28

手把手教你用YOLOv13镜像快速实现图像识别

手把手教你用YOLOv13镜像快速实现图像识别 在AI工程实践中,最让人头疼的往往不是模型本身,而是环境配置。明明代码写得完美无缺,却因为依赖版本不匹配、CUDA驱动缺失或Python环境混乱而无法运行——这种“在我机器上能跑”的尴尬场景屡见不鲜…

作者头像 李华